19 Bourg-d‘Oisans - Aspes-sur-Buëch
By climbing over the Col d‘Ornon along the river Lignare we arrive in the Valbonais and the Lake du Sautet. But this is not enough for the day ! Passing the Défilé de la Souloise and St-Disdier we will pass the Col de Festre to reach the Pays de Büech and our destination in Aspres-sur-Buëch.

Cycling along the river Buech will get us further south to Sisteron at the once wild but now tamed river Durance; we have definitely left the Haute-Alpes and the Dauphiné and are now in the Hâute Provence for sure. Climb the the road through the Gorge de la Méonge or to the top of the Montagne de Lure, Signal de Lure if the normal route to St-Etienne-en-Orgues is not enough of a challenge to you.s point

Cycle for 2.5 kms on busy N91 in direction Grenoble before turning left on D526 ---> Col-d‘Ornon, --> La-Mure over said pass to Entraigues
( + 650m , - 560m , km 29 ).

Continue on D526 ---> Valbonais and ---> La-Mure and 3.5 km after Valbonais ( km 36 ) at the Pont-de-Prêtre exit D526 by turning left to cross the bridge. After another 1.5 km turn left into D212b which leads you ( 5 km ) to N85, the „Route Napoléon“ . Turn left again on N85 and cycle all the way to ---> Corps
( + 201m , -135m , km 60.5)

Entering Corps turn right, down to the valley on D66 ---> Lac-du-Sautet, ---> St-Etienne-en-Dévoluy and cross the dam of the lake and climb on the other side to Pellafol which you pass to cross the small plain into and through the Gorge of the River Soulaise to St- Disdier. At St-Distier do not downhill to the left but turn right, uphill on D937 ---> Col-du-Festre
( + 675m , - 135m , km 87 )

Downhill from the pass and where the downhill is running out ( km 2 from pass ) turn right at the last narrow spot, over bridge to take a short cut along the slopes to your right. Cross the the N994 with a left, 100m, right zig-zag and crossing the rails ---> Les-Parais. cycle along the Buëch River for ca. 4.5 kms to the no-taffic sign where you turn right back to N995. Left on N995 for 2.5 kms when you turn right over railway and hill to ---> Aspes-sur-Buëch
( +40 m , 720m , km 115 ).

21 Sisteron - Moustiers-Ste-Marie
We leave Sisteron south on N85. After busy 6.5 km we finally exit the main road right, direction ---> Chateauneuf-Val-St-Donat. After a sharp climb we pass Châteauneuf and descend on D 801 and D101 passing the forested „Ravine-Marda“ back to the Durance River / Valley which we cross together with all the main roads to bike into ---> Les Mées
( + 100m , - 160m . km 22 ).

Proceed south on D4 and cycle between the Durance River at right and the Canal-d‘ Oraison at left to reach the town of the same name ---> Oraison
( -50m , km 37 ).

Still on D4 and further south we will the river Asse confluent to the Durance. On the other side turn left and uphill on D15 to climb to the Plateau Valensole and the town ---> Valensole
( +260m , -10m , km 54 ).

Cross the plain east on D56 ---> Puimoisson where you turn right on road D952 to ---> Moustieres-Ste-Marie
( +40m ,-60m , km 83 ).
